What you’re looking at
This page consists primarily of **advertisements**, not political satire. The main content includes: **Maillard Chocolates ad** (top left): A straightforward luxury candy advertisement emphasizing 60 years of quality. **Pyrene Fire Extinguisher ad** (center/right): The largest ad, featuring a photograph of a man holding a fire extinguisher. It appeals to domestic safety consciousness with the tagline "Love's first duty is protection," urging homeowners to consider fire risk. This reflects early-20th-century consumer anxiety about household fires. **Listerine mouthwash ad** (bottom left): Standard hygiene advertising. **"Mid-Ocean" humor section** (bottom right): Brief satirical exchanges about the Titanic disaster, with dark jokes about insufficient lifeboats and the band's final song. This references the 1912 sinking. The page shows how magazines blended commercial advertising with light humor and social commentary typical of the era.
